Source: Coinmarketcap Technical Analysis Of Bitcoin’s (BTC) Price Movements In 2021, Bitcoin started the year at $29,374.15, hit its all-time high above $68k, and ended the year at $46,306.45. What was Bitcoin’s lowest price ? : CoinMarketCap records Bitcoin’s all-time low as $65.53 on the 5th of June 2013. Highest Bitcoin price ever : Bitcoin’s all-time high is $68,789.63, which it reached on the 10th of November 2021. BTC wasn’t given value until July 2010, when exchanges began to sell it for $0.09. What was Bitcoin’s starting price? : Bitcoin was worth $0 when it was first introduced to potential users in 2009. Let’s look over some of Bitcoin’s most important price movements.
